ADD Medication For Adults

general-medical-council-logo.pngA GP may refer adults to an ADHD specialist clinic to be assessed for medication.

The drugs used to treat ADHD can help people become more focused, less impulsive, and more calm. These medications are known as stimulant medicines.

Stimulants increase the levels of chemical messengers in your brain, which allow you to concentrate. They are the first choice for treatment.

Stimulants

Stimulants are drugs that stimulates the central nervous system to help you focus. They also reduce impulsivity and hyperactivity. They increase dopamine levels, an important neurotransmitter in motivation and attention span. They are the most frequently prescribed ADD medications for adults. However, they come with potential risks that require closely monitored.

Stimulants and non stimulant adhd medications for adults-stimulants are the two main categories of medications for ADHD. Stimulants are the most well-known and have been around longer and include the methylphenidate group of medications (like Ritalin) and amphetamine salts (like Adderall). They can be either short-acting or lengthy-acting, and are often described as immediate release or a modified release. Short-acting stimulants last for two to three hours and are recommended as a first-time dosage for patients to get an impression of how they feel on the medication.

When people think of ADHD medication, they often picture the methylphenidate and amphetamine drugs that they've seen in the media. These are often referred to by their names as brand names, like Ritalin concerta adhd medication Adderall Vyvanse. They are all legal under a doctor's care and can be prescribed for Adhd Medication adults uk in adults.

The medications are generally accepted by both children and adults. However there are a few negative effects you need to be aware of, for example sleep issues, fatigue and a loss of appetite. These are usually reversible by adjustments to the dosage or the timing of medication. If the symptoms don't get better then you might need to consult your psychiatrist regarding a new treatment program.

It is important to be aware that medications prescribed for ADHD can cause dependency and addiction if they are misused. The MHRA regulates these medications to ensure their safety and appropriate use.
